PN17 firm Zelan appoints new CEO


PETALING JAYA: PN17 company Zelan Bhd has appointed Faizal Yusof, 46, as its chief executive officer (CEO).

In a filing with Bursa Malaysia, the construction engineering firm said Faizal brings with him more than 23 years of experience in the engineering, construction, and infrastructure sectors.

“The board is confident that Faizal’s proven leadership capabilities, strategic acumen and deep industry knowledge will contribute positively to the company’s turnaround initiatives and its ongoing PN17 regularisation efforts.”

Zelan’s previous CEO, Mohd Ariff Abd Samat (42), resigned in November last year after just three months to pursue other career opportunities. The company appointed Shareena Shahril as its acting CEO to replace Mohd Ariff.

Zelan fell into PN17 categorisation in May 2023 after its external auditor Nexia SSY PLT expressed a disclaimer of opinion on its audited financial statements for the financial year ended Dec 31, 2022.
